This was a bad move for Donaire, good move for Rigo. Rigo gets to sit on the side and only fight once, gets a shot at the unified champ while not having to earn it. Donaire just freaking fought and prob has residual injuries or whatever.
Otherwise it would have been Rigo vs Casimero, then if Rigo wins, rematch Donaire for the unification. 2 fights to get the unification and a risk he loses to Casimero, vs now just 1 fight and a guarantee at the unification with no risk of a loss first.
